Abstract

The use of technology to facilitate educational activities amid the Covid-19 pandemic era is becoming an urgency in the academic world today. This is intended so that the teaching and learning process remains conducive, including the process of internship activities that must be followed by students. Continuing our previous studies to build a more modern and suitable internship program, we build an internship system called Excellent Internship System (EIS). This internship system is based on a website platform that can be adopted in higher education institutions. The platform has been developed through the Research and Development (R&D) method with five IT and education experts, as well as thirty students who have taken internships during the Covid-19 pandemic in 2020. The EIS platform was developed by considering user-friendly aspects, easy access for lecturers, students, and even the institutions where internships were hosted, therefore it is also could be the supportive facility for the internships process.
